The American Society of Echocardiography (ASE) will hold its 2026 Scientific Sessions June 26 to 28 at the Gaylord Rockies Resort and Convention Center in Aurora, CO, with 2,000 cardiovascular imaging professionals expected to attend.
The conference will feature nearly 100 educational sessions, more than 500 original research abstracts, and four late-breaking abstracts covering AI applications, approaches to evaluating severe aortic stenosis, and next-generation ultrasound enhancing agents, according to the ASE. Hands-on offerings include an Echo Discovery Zone with interactive learning stations, virtual reality sessions on cardiac anatomy and echocardiographic imaging, and workshops covering hypertrophic cardiomyopathy, point-of-care ultrasound (POCUS), structural imaging, and pediatric 3D and strain echocardiography.
The Echo Expo exhibit hall will feature more than 60 exhibitors, six Science and Technology Theaters, and an Accelerator Hub spotlighting five start-up companies. A Shark Tank Innovation Competition will also feature four competitors pitching cardiovascular solutions to a panel of venture capitalists and experts.














![Examples of ultrasound findings and techniques. (A) Images in a 39-year-old male patient with a mass in the left thigh. The mass is heterogeneous on the B-mode US image (compared with the patient in D) and showed increased microvascularity (superb microvascular imaging [SMI]) and shear-wave elastography (SWE) values. Undifferentiated pleomorphic sarcoma was diagnosed at biopsy (with pleomorphic rhabdomyosarcoma in surgical specimen). (B) Images in an 18-year-old male patient with a mass in the left leg. The mass is hypoechoic on the B-mode image, with no other findings suggestive of malignancy. The lesion is in contact with the cortex of the tibia, which is slightly irregular. CT revealed a doubtful anteromedial tibial erosion. The microvascular study demonstrated high vascularization, suggestive of malignancy. Periosteal Ewing sarcoma was diagnosed with both histologic and immunohistochemical confirmation. (C) Images in a 69-year-old female patient with a lump growing on the outside of the left leg. Multiple SWE examinations were performed (please note the high values obtained in the measurements, whereas the color map highlights the stiffness relative to adjacent tissues). SMI showed areas of increased vascularization to target for sampling. Undifferentiated spindle cell sarcoma was diagnosed at biopsy, with residual leiomyosarcoma in the surgical specimen after neoadjuvant therapy. (D) Images in a 56-year-old female patient with a mass in the right thigh. The mass is heterogeneous at both B-mode ultrasound (similar to patient A) and MRI (coronal T2-weighted spectral attenuated inversion recovery [SPAIR]; T1-weighted pre-contrast and postcontrast imaging), which even shows uptake after the administration of paramagnetic contrast material, which is traditionally suggestive of malignancy. Low values at SMI and elastography are suggestive of benignity. Spindle cell lipoma was diagnosed at biopsy, with atypical spindle cell lipomatous tumor in the surgical specimen.](https://img.auntminnie.com/mindful/smg/workspaces/default/uploads/2026/08/images-radiol250278fig2.APCFLSvX6p.jpg?auto=format%2Ccompress&fit=crop&h=112&q=70&w=112)
